黑马程序员前端微信小程序开发教程,微信小程序从基础到发布全流程_企业级商城实战(

避坑笔记
如果以下配置对你有帮助记得投币哟 !
该笔记避开的是较大的坑 , 小的就看弹幕就能解决!
P140 初始化Vuex
Vue3版本 state无法读取问题
文件配置
store.js

main.js

P156 收货地址API失效问题
官方调整 API
官方公告 :
https://developers.weixin.qq.com/community/develop/doc/000a02f2c5026891650e7f40351c01
uni-app API :
https://uniapp.dcloud.io/collocation/manifest.html#mp-weixin
PS:
uni-app官方打错了个单词 !!! 我看了半天...

requirePrivateInfos != requiredPrivateInfos
(官方少打了个d)
解决方案 :
manifest.js

组件中的 chooseAddress()方法 参考

P172 登录授权问题
官方又调整 API
官方公告 : https://developers.weixin.qq.com/community/develop/doc/000cacfa20ce88df04cb468bc52801
微信官方 API : https://developers.weixin.qq.com/miniprogram/dev/api/open-api/user-info/wx.getUserProfile.html
uni-app API : https://uniapp.dcloud.io/api/plugins/login.html#getuserprofile
解决方案 :
组件 my-login.vue


P176 Token获取问题
关于这问题弹幕有人说了, 就是登录授权不要这么多人 , 我们发出请求后 看到状态码为 400 也可以理解为请求成功!
剩下我们只需生成Token即可
解决方案 : (其他跟老师打就可以了)

配置文件加载问题
说白了就是加载的缓存区未得到更新加载
删除以下文件夹重新加载即可
PS : 运行过程是删除不掉的 (dddd

每次调用官方API 出现问题 , 我都能隐约的感觉到肯定是官方出的问题 , 我代码怎么可能有事!! (狗头)
个人博客 https://www.bozhu12.cc . 欢迎学习/评论~